讓我們談談 Jamstack 的未來 — 加入我們

bashblog

1535 個星標
209 個分支
18 個議題
首頁
https://github.com/cfenollosa/bashblog
儲存庫
cfenollosa/bashblog
語言
Bash
授權條款
GPL-3.0-only

Bashblog 的創建源於需要一種非常、非常簡單的方法,透過使用[我伺服器上的]公用資料夾來發布部落格文章,而不需要任何特殊要求和依賴項。可在 GNU/Linux、OSX 和 BSD 上運行。

有多簡單?只需輸入「./bb.sh post」並開始撰寫您的部落格文章。

功能

  • 超簡單的使用方式:只需使用您喜歡的編輯器輸入文章,剩下的由腳本完成。無需樣板。
  • 無需安裝。下載 bb.sh 並開始寫部落格。
  • 零依賴項。它僅在基本工具(date、basename、grep、sed、head 等)上運行。
  • 開箱即用,與 GNU/Linux、BSD 和 OSX 相容,無需在 Mac 上安裝 GNU coreutils。它會進行一些神奇的操作,以自動偵測它需要運行的命令切換,具體取決於您的系統。
  • 所有內容都是靜態的。您只需要對具有公用網路資料夾的機器進行 Shell 存取。提示:進階使用者可以透過 ftpfs 掛載遠端的公用資料夾,並在本地運行此腳本。
  • 允許草稿,包含一個簡單但乾淨的樣式表,並自動產生 RSS 檔案。
  • 支援標籤/類別
  • 支援 Markdown、Disqus、Twitter、Feedburner、Google Analytics。
  • 該專案在 2016 年仍然維護中。錯誤會被修復,並且會考慮新功能(請參閱「貢獻」)。
  • 所有內容都儲存在一個約 1k 行的 Bash 腳本中,這不是很酷嗎?! ;)

尋找更多靜態網站產生器